HEALTH NEWS
- ➤ Scientists developed a blood test that predicts when Alzheimer’s symptoms may start within three to four years, according to a study published in Nature Medicine. The test uses plasma p-tau217 levels and could speed up clinical trials—reported from Oakland. KTVU

REAL ESTATE NEWS
- ➤ Tenants at a downtown Oakland apartment building are seeking relocation payments after a January fire displaced 200 residents due to alleged code violations, though landlord Ted Dang denies liability. A city hearing on Monday questioned his claims, and a final decision is expected in a few days. KTVU
